Outdoor Living Spaces

Outdoor gatherings used to focus around a patio or deck and decorating was limited to generic lawn furniture such as an umbrella table with chairs. Today however, outdoor designing has taken its cue from your favorite indoor rooms and created an entire living space that is as comfortable and functional as it is pleasing to the eye.

These unique spaces can include seating areas, eating areas and even a fully-functional kitchen. You can have fireplaces, stoves, refrigerators and of course, those all-important tables and chairs. But forget vinyl cushions… today’s outdoor furniture is as lush and inviting as what you’d expect to find in your den.

Build Your Outdoor Living Space

To create an outdoor living space, you first need to decide what you want that space to do. Remember that your garden, courtyard, play yard and other outdoor landscaping can (and should!) be coordinated with your outdoor living space, just as you might tie your living room décor to the foyer or adjacent dining area.

The best way to do this is to map out your entire landscape, outdoor living area and all. Your space can be as simple or as grand as you want it to be so take some time to play around with different ideas. For example, if you’d like a spacious place to entertain, you might want to consider a covered deck, patio or even a large pergola in the center of your yard. If you want to cook outside as well, think about built-in grills or even a pizza oven for a fun twist on outdoor cooking.

Clean up is another consideration so if you’ll be cooking, you might want a working sink as well to avoid multiple trips to your house. Your space can also include cabinets, racks, shelves and anything else you’d like to incorporate to make the space functional and comfortable.

Fine-Tuning Your Your Outdoor Living Space

Colors, textures and lighting can have the same glorious effects on your outdoor living area as they do within your home. Illuminated walkways and tiki torches are just the beginning. A professional contractors can install a variety of beautiful lighting fixtures in your outdoor space, making the transition from a daytime pool party for the kids to an evening dinner party for the grownups as easy as flipping the switch.

As for colors, keep your vibrant landscape design in mind when choosing your color schemes. You’ll want something that doesn’t show dirt easily but also compliments your personal preferences as well as the rest of your landscape.

Throw pillows, countertops and other decorative implements all come into play here and because your outdoor space will change with the seasons, you might want to choose something that’s easily coordinated with a variety of looks.
